Undercover Jetsetter breaks fresh ground in new media as a travel show that is shot, edited, and delivered almost entirely on the iPhone – just like everyone does when they’re on vacation. Co-hosted and Co-produced by John Daly and Susan Anzalone.
Co-hosted and Co-produced by John Daly, the pioneering reality TV host of Real TV, and Susan Anzalone, a food and wine expert with a travel and entertainment background, they travel the world bringing you to well-known places as well as finding off-the-beaten path gems to taste and imbibe in food and drink of the region, all while getting in a few rounds of golf. Their book, The TV Studio in Your Hand, is available on Amazon and shows people how to create great videos and even their own TV shows on their smart phones.

With dozens of half hour shows produced, and more in production, that span the globe with fun and exciting places that people are dying to visit. We include wine reviews and stress-free recipes for meals and cocktails in the kitchen, so the audience can be a jetsetter at home. The show shares regional experiences of cultures around the world as well as tips and easy tricks while traveling. Using the iPhone to shoot the show rather many cameras and a large crew, allows for more intimate encounters and magical insights, hence the name Undercover Jetsetter.
